Education is one of the fundamental pillars of the AAMD’s
mission statement. This expansion of space is going to allow for
more education, more students and a more diverse delivery
of curriculum. In addition, these training spaces are an
added member benefi t. Members with internal training
departments can now utilize this space to off er their
own curriculum in the hands-on format.
VISION
The AAMD aims to off er the highest level of
education to its membership through new training
spaces, new curriculum and innovative ways to
deliver that education. The expansion of current
training spaces and addition of the HOME Room
allows AAMD to off er more classes annually
which provides more opportunities for members
to pursue their professional development goals.
In addition, the HOME Room will now provide
a kinesthetic learning style that wasn’t previously
available.
WHAT TO EXPECT
High energy, fun and hands-on! This new training
space was built for maintenance professionals BY
maintenance professionals. The HOME Room is state
of the art but allows maintenance teams to get their hands
dirty by not only learning how to fi x something, but by truly
fi xing it in the classroom setting. The HOME Room is nothing
like a typical classroom environment. Yes, there are tables, chairs
and a screen for a PowerPoint, but this space off ers fl exibility and
encourages students to get up, move around and dive into the equipment
they have at their fi ngertips.
